How do I change view source?
Here, we just want to change the source code editor.
- Open Internet Explorer.
- Press the F12 button to start the Developer Tools.
- Click on File; Choose Customize Internet Explorer View Source.
- Three options are presented: Default Viewer, Notepad, Other"¦
- You can use Notepad or select Other for an editor of your choice.
How do I view the source code in Internet Explorer?
To get started go to the “Tools Menu” and click on “Developer Tools” or press “F12” to access the “Developer Tools Window”. Once you have the “Developer Tools Window” open go to the “File Menu”, then “Customize Internet Explorer View Source”, and click on “Other”.

How do I change the source code of a website permanently?
Visit a web page that you want to make permanent changes on. Switch to the Sources panel in the Developer Tools. Click on the icon with the two arrows pointing to the left, and select Overrides from the menu. Select “setup overrides” and pick a local folder that you want to store the overrides in.

How do you view source code?
Open the Google Chrome browser on your Android phone or tablet. Open the web page whose source code you'd like to view. Tap once in the address bar and move the cursor to the front of the URL. Type view-source: and tap Enter or Go.

How do I change the source code in Internet Explorer?
You can either press F12 on your keyboard or click on Tools and then click on Developer Tools. Another IE window will pop up and here you want to click on File, then Customize Internet Explorer View Source and then choose from the options.

How do I open an HTML file in Internet Explorer 11?
You can also press "Ctrl-O" in your browser to open a file selection window. Navigate to the HTML file you wish to open and double-click it to you that file in your browser. Internet Explorer becomes your default browser when you install Windows. It will launch when you double-click an HTML file.
